Top 5 3D Anime Games Performance in Netherlands: Q2 2021
Explore the performance trends of the top 3D anime games in the Netherlands during Q2 2021, with insights on down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the second quarter of 2021, the top five 3D anime games in the Netherlands showed diverse trends across downloads, revenue, and active users, as reported by Sensor Tower.
Genshin Impact reported a fluctuating weekly revenue, peaking at roughly $68K in late June. Downloads saw a spike in mid-May with approximately 4K downloads, while active users consistently hovered around the 25K mark, peaking at 28.7K in mid-May.
Summoners War had a notable revenue increase in mid-April, reaching around $43K. Despite a modest download rate, peaking at 378 in late May, active user numbers remained steady, fluctuating around 10K throughout the quarter.
The Seven Deadly Sins showed a significant revenue spike in late June, reaching approximately $43K. Downloads experienced a high point in late April with 2.4K, while active users maintained a stable presence, averaging around 7K.
DRAGON BALL LEGENDS experienced a notable surge in revenue at the end of May, with figures around $39K. Downloads peaked at 1.5K in mid-June, and active users remained consistent, slightly dropping from 14.2K to 12.6K over the quarter.
Lastly, Ulala: Idle Adventure showed a revenue peak of approximately $17.5K in mid-June. The download numbers were modest, with the highest being 1K in early April, while active users saw a decline from 5.5K to 4.2K over the quarter.
